Strange Maps ran across a wristwatch-like contraption from the 1920s that holds little scrolls of paper used for navigation , an analog version of Hertz's NeverLost and other in-car GPS navigation systems. This fantastic contraption, called the 'Routefinder', showed 1920s drivers in the UK the roads they were travelling down, gave them the mileage covered and told them to stop when they came at journey's end. The technology -- a curious cross between the space age and the stone age -- consisted of a little map scroll inside a watch, to be 'scrolled' (hence the word) as the driver moved along on the map. I'm going to do a very New Agey thing. I don't do a lot of them. This week I am going to start building my own "personal treasure map."Here is the logic behind the effort: One gathers up pictures of things/conditions/states of being that one would like in ones own life. These images and any relevant text/ sayings are then glued onto a larger sheet of paper, forming a collage of wishes and dreams for ones life. The notion is that by accepting and gathering these things together, that I would be signaling God or the Universe or both in some way. It is like a visual prayer. It is an announcement, a gesture of hope, a projection into the future. It is claiming what I want "in front of God and everybody". Shakti Gawain , author of "Cretive Visualization", suggests the following: A treasure map is an actual, physical picture of your desired reality. It is valuable because it forms an especially clear, sharp image which can then attract and focus energy into your goal. It works along the same lines as a blueprint for a building. You can make a treasure map by drawing or painting it, or by making a collage using pictures and words cut from magazines, books or cards, photographs, drawings, and so on. Don't worry if you're not artistically accomplished. Simple, childlike treasure Maps are just as effective as great works of art!
